Veritas Christian Academy is 9-1 against Abundant Life Academy since February of 2021,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Friday. Veritas Christian Academy's road trip will continue as they head out to face Abundant Life Academy at 3:30 p.m. on February 23rd. Hopefully Veritas Christian Academy focused on turnovers this week since the team gave up 19 last Thursday.
Last Thursday, Veritas Christian Academy came up short against Vernon and fell 45-36. That's two games in a row now that Veritas Christian Academy has lost by exactly nine points.
Even though the team lost, they still had their share of impressive performances. One of the best came from Caitlin O'Malley, who scored 12 points along with five rebounds and two steals. She hasn't dropped below two steals for nine straight games. Amya Cuddon was another key contributor, scoring 14 points.
Meanwhile, with a playoff game on the line, Abundant Life Academy rose to the challenge on Tuesday. They came out on top against the by a score of 34-26. The victory was a breath of fresh air for Abundant Life Academy as it put an end to their three-game losing streak.
Abundant Life Academy got their win on the backs of several key players, but it was Analissa Bravo out in front who scored nine points. Another player making a difference was Yohanah Morvan, who scored six points along with seven rebounds.
Veritas Christian Academy's defeat dropped their record down to 20-4. As for Abundant Life Academy, their victory bumped their record up to 3-14.
Everything came up roses for Veritas Christian Academy against Abundant Life Academy in their previous meeting back in December of 2023 as the team secured a 54-21 victory. In that match, Veritas Christian Academy amassed a halftime lead of 32-7, an impressive feat they'll look to repeat on Friday.
